# Tile Prefetcher settings (Cartowl plugin API)
# The prefetcher walks zoom levels 4-12 and caches tiles
# ahead of the viewport. Plugins may override the ring
# radius but not the eviction policy. Keep batch size
# under 200 or the fetch queue stalls. Prefetch state and
# tile metadata persist in the cache database; the
# prefetcher connects using the value on the next line.

primary connection of kahof-kagep = mssql://belath_svc:3uqY4g6LHG5Nyi@db-d0ba.ferralabs.corp:5432/rusdor

**16:05 — Checkout load test goes sideways**

For the sync: we pointed the Hargrove load generator at the Pebbleton checkout flow at 4x normal traffic, and the payment-intent service started queueing hard around minute twelve. Latency p99 hit 9s before Dario killed the run. Good news: no dropped orders, just slow ones. We're rerunning tomorrow with the connection pool doubled. That run was tagged with the trace token below.

build token for kajeg-bageg: htk6_abeb3e

Subject: Cut-over complete — Lattice UI library versioning

Hi all — the move to strict semantic versioning for the Lattice component library finished last night. Consumers now pin exact minor versions; the old "latest" channel is frozen. Please review the publish pipeline changes carefully, especially the pre-release tagging logic. The registry service now runs with the configuration shown below.

service settings:
novath:
  pin: 1396
  tenant: pelys
  seal: seal_ccc035e1
  metrics_host: metrics.novath.qorvelworks.test
  standby_team: fraeth
  escalation: drueth-zorok
  nonce: 61d508